Types of Charging AC Freon
When it comes to Charging AC Freon, there are several types available that are designed to cater to different systems and needs:
- R-22: Commonly used in residential air conditioning units, R-22 is known for its effective heat absorption capabilities. However, due to environmental regulations, its usage is being phased out.
- R-410A: This is a popular alternative to R-22, providing greater efficiency and lower ozone depletion potential. It’s commonly found in newer air conditioning systems.
- R-134A: Often used in automotive AC systems, R-134A is efficient but not as effective as the R-410A in residential applications.
- R-32: An environmentally friendly option, R-32 offers superior performance with a lower global warming potential compared to traditional refrigerants.
